Nevelsky District, Pskov Oblast
Nevelsky District is an administrative and municipal district (raion), one of the twenty-four in Pskov OblastRussia. It is located in the south of the oblast and borders with Novosokolnichesky District in the north, Velikoluksky District in the east, Usvyatsky District in the southeast, HaradokPolatsk, and Rasony Districts of Vitebsk Oblast of Belarus in the south (forming part of the Belarus–Russia border), Sebezhsky District in the west, and with Pustoshkinsky District in the northwest. The area of the district is . Its administrative center is the town of Nevel. Population: 31,419 (2002 Census); The population of Nevel accounts for 61.2% of the district's total population.
